    Hi I have a Dell Optiplex GX620 running Windows 7. Every time I turn it on it goes into a loop restarting by it's self when you go into start up repair it does fix it, but every time it is shut down the problem starts all over again.

    Try running a chkdsk on your Win7 partition. Computer>right-click C: drive and select Properties>Tools>Error Checking>Check Now button>Tick both boxes and Start button. It will schedule for next reboot. When you reboot let it run and see if it starts without problems.

    Also go into Disk Management (just type disk management in the Start/Search box) and see if you have a System Reserved partition (about 100mb). If the chkdsk on C: doesn't work maybe doing one on the System Reserved partition (if it exists) might be worth a try.
